Is KozyShack Original Recipe Rice Pudding Alpha-Gal?

Description
Sweet, mildly vanilla-flavored dessert with a creamy, slightly grainy texture; commonly eaten chilled or warmed as a snack or after-meal treat. Reviewers frequently cite nostalgic taste, convenient ready-to-eat packaging, and consistent sweetness, while some report texture variation, varying sweetness across batches, and occasional minor packaging concerns in delivery and storage.

Ingredients
Calcium, Potassium, Reduced Fat Milk, Rice, Cane Sugar, Contains Less Than 2% Of Eggs, Salt, Natural Flavors,. Contains Milk, Eggs.
What is a Alpha-Gal diet?
An Alpha-Gal diet eliminates mammalian meat and products containing mammalian-derived ingredients to prevent allergic reactions in people with alpha-gal syndrome. This includes beef, pork, lamb, dairy products, gelatin, and certain medications derived from mammals. The condition involves a specific sugar molecule found in most mammals, often triggered after a tick bite. People may experience delayed allergic reactions 3-6 hours after consuming trigger foods. The diet focuses on safe alternatives like poultry, fish, and plant-based proteins. When followed carefully, often with guidance from an allergist or dietitian, it can prevent serious reactions while maintaining adequate nutrition.
